On the Court
Basketball is a game of skill, but it's also a game of heart. You have to be willing to put in the hard work and dedication if you want to be successful. There will be times when you fail, but you have to learn from your mistakes and keep moving forward.
One of the most important things I've learned on the court is the importance of teamwork. Basketball is a team sport, and you can't win without your teammates. You have to be willing to work together and sacrifice for each other. When you do, anything is possible.
I've also learned the importance of mental toughness. There will be times when things don't go your way. You have to be able to stay focused and keep fighting. The best players are able to overcome adversity and find a way to win.
